London: The OTT platform Netflix’s popular show ‘The Crown’ season 5 (Season 5) has been released recently. This web series seems to be winning the hearts of the fans. The story of the series has been elaborately highlighted on the life of Princess Diana. In ‘The Crown’, the role of Princess Diana has been played very vividly by Hollywood actress Elizabeth DiBakey. When heart surgeon Dr. Hasnat Khan is played by Pakistani actor Humayun Saeed. During an interview, the Pakistani actor shared many things about the series. In the questions asked in the interview, Humayun Saeed was asked whether all his scenes have been shown in ‘The Crown’? He replied that an important scene was cut. In this scene, Princess Diana meets heart surgeon Dr. Hasnat Khan said that he wanted to accept Islam.Dr. This conversation between Hasnat Khan and Princess Diana is not shown in the series.
Why was the scene cut?
Elaborating on why the scene was cut, Humayun Saeed, who plays a heart surgeon in ‘The Crown’, says that the scene was from the 9th episode. This episode was timed out. That’s why this scene was removed. Humayun Saeed says that this scene was one of his favorite scenes as Princess Diana expressed her desire to convert to Islam for her love. However, unfortunately the actor’s favorite scene did not make it to the popular OTT series.
